Biscuit Bubble Up this Recipe

Ingredients:

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 medium onion, chopped
  • 1 (15 ounce) can tomato sauce
  • 1 (10.75 ounce) can condensed cream of mushroom soup
  • 1 teaspoon dried Italian seasoning
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 (16 ounce) cans refrigerated biscuit dough, cut into quarters
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ese

Preparing the Meat Sauce:

Okay, let’s get started! First, we need to make a delicious and flavorful meat sauce. This is the foundation of our Biscuit Bubble Up, so we want to make sure it’s packed with flavor.

  1. Brown the Ground Beef: In a large skillet or Dutch oven, brown the ground beef over medium-high heat. As it cooks, break it up with a spoon or spatula until it’s crumbled into small pieces. Make sure to cook it thoroughly until there’s no pink remaining. Drain off any excess grease. Nobody wants a greasy bubble up!
  2. Sauté the Onion: Add the chopped onion to the skillet with the cooked ground beef. Cook until the onion is softened and translucent, about 5-7 minutes. This will add a nice sweetness and depth of flavor to the sauce. Stir occasionally to prevent the onion from burning.
  3. Add Tomato Sauce and Soup: Pour in the can of tomato sauce and the can of condensed cream of mushroom soup. Stir well to combine everything. The cream of mushroom soup adds a creamy richness that complements the tomato sauce perfectly.
  4. Season the Sauce: Now it’s time to season our sauce! Add the dried Italian seasoning,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Stir everything together and taste the sauce. Adjust the seasonings as needed to your liking. I usually add a little extra garlic powder because I love garlic! Remember, you can always add more, but you can’t take it away.
  5. Simmer the Sauce: Reduce the heat to low, cover the skillet, and let the sauce simmer for about 15-20 minutes. This allows the flavors to meld together and deepen. Stir occasionally to prevent sticking. While the sauce is simmering, you can prepare the biscuits.

Preparing the Biscuits:

While the meat sauce is simmering away, let’s get the biscuits ready. This is the “bubble up” part of our dish, and it’s super easy!

  1.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Make sure your oven is properly preheated for even baking.
  2. Prepare the Biscuits: Open the cans of refrigerated biscuit dough. On a cutting board, use a knife or kitchen shears to cut each biscuit into quarters. You should end up with small, bite-sized pieces.

Assembling and Baking:

Now for the fun part – putting everything together and baking it until it’s golden brown and bubbly!

  1. Combine Sauce and Biscuits: Remove the meat sauce from the heat. Add the quartered biscuit pieces to the skillet and stir gently to coat them evenly with the sauce. Make sure all the biscuit pieces are nicely coated so they bake up nicely.
  2. Transfer to Baking Dish (Optional): If your skillet is oven-safe, you can bake the bubble up directly in the skillet. If not, transfer the mixture to a greased 9×13 inch baking dish. I usually use a baking dish for easier serving.
  3. Top with Cheese: Sprinkle the shredded cheddar cheese evenly over the top of the biscuit and sauce mixture. The cheese will melt and create a delicious, cheesy crust.
  4. Bake: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the biscuits are cooked through and the cheese is melted and bubbly. The biscuits should be golden brown on top. Keep an eye on it, as baking times can vary depending on your oven.
  5. Let it Rest: Remove the Biscuit Bubble Up from the oven and let it rest for a few minutes before serving. This allows the sauce to thicken slightly and prevents it from being too runny.

Tips and Variations:

This Biscuit Bubble Up is a great base recipe, but you can easily customize it to your liking. Here are a few ideas:

  • Add Vegetables: Feel free to add other vegetables to the meat sauce, such as diced bell peppers, mushrooms, or zucchini. Sauté them along with the onion.
  • Use Different Cheese: Experiment with different types of cheese, such as mozzarella, Monterey Jack, or pepper jack.
  • Spice it Up: Add a pinch of red pepper flakes or a dash of hot sauce to the meat sauce for a little heat.
  • Use Different Meat: You can substitute ground turkey or ground chicken for the ground beef.
  • Add Beans: Add a can of drained and rinsed kidney beans or black beans to the meat sauce for extra protein and fiber.
  • Make it Vegetarian: Omit the ground beef and use a vegetarian ground beef substitute or add more vegetables.
  • Garlic Bread Biscuits: Before baking, brush the tops of the biscuits with melted garlic butter for a garlic bread twist.
  • Pizza Bubble Up: Use pizza sauce instead of tomato sauce, add pepperoni or sausage, and top with mozzarella cheese for a pizza-flavored bubble up.
  • Cream Cheese Swirl: Before baking, dollop small spoonfuls of cream cheese over the top and swirl it in with a knife for a creamy, tangy flavor.
  • Herbs: Fresh herbs like parsley, basil, or oregano can be added to the sauce or sprinkled on top after baking for a burst of freshness.

Storage Instructions:

Leftovers can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the microwave or oven until heated through.

Make-Ahead Instructions:

You can prepare the meat sauce ahead of time and store it in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. When ready to bake, simply combine the sauce with the biscuits and bake as directed.

Troubleshooting:

  • Biscuits are not cooking through: Make sure your oven is properly preheated and that the biscuits are evenly coated with the sauce. If the top is browning too quickly, cover the dish with foil for the last few minutes of baking.
  • Sauce is too runny: Let the bubble up rest for a few minutes after baking to allow the sauce to thicken. You can also add a tablespoon of cornstarch to the sauce while it’s simmering to help thicken it.
  • Biscuits are too dry: Make sure the biscuits are well coated with the sauce before baking. You can also brush the tops of the biscuits with melted butter before baking to help keep them moist.
